基本几何体教学在机械制图中是非常重要的内容,常见的几何体有圆柱、圆锥、棱柱、正方体等,这些常见的几何体在数学课程中又有另外的定义,叫“空间几何体”。职业学校的教学培养目标是非常明确的,主要以服务专业应用、技能为目的,但在中职高二数学教材内容上,还不能有效地围绕这个目标和原则来开展教学工作。主要论述在中职的数学课程如何结合机械制图教学中基本几何体的教学,让数学知识与机械制图教学紧紧联系在一起,发挥它们彼此的价值和作用,同时也让学生更好地把数学知识应用到机械专业中,培养学生应用数学知识服务于专业的技能,让专业知识的学习达到更好的效果。
Basic geometry teaching is very important in mechanical drawing. Common geometric bodies are cylinders, cones, prisms, cubes, etc. These common geometric bodies have another definition in mathematics course called “spatial geometry”. The goal of teaching and training of vocational schools is very clear. The main purpose is to serve professional applications and skills. However, in the content of mathematics teaching materials for secondary vocational schools, we can not effectively carry out teaching work around this goal and principle. Mainly discusses how the mathematics curriculum in secondary vocational education combined with the teaching of basic geometry in mechanical drawing teaching, so that mathematical knowledge and mechanical drawing teaching closely linked to play their mutual value and role, but also to enable students to better mathematical knowledge Applied to the mechanical profession, training students to apply mathematical knowledge to professional skills, so that professional learning to achieve better results.
